Naming Ceremony (Namkaran) — Earrings

The naming ceremony, or Namkaran, is typically held between the eleventh and forty-first day of a child's life. It is the first public introduction of the child's name — and in many families, the first occasion for gifting gold.

At this stage, the gift needs to be very small, very light, and safe for a newborn's sensitive skin. A pair of fine gold stud earrings is the natural choice.

LadyBug Jewels earrings are made in 14K and 18K BIS Hallmark gold, using hypoallergenic metals chosen specifically for children's skin. The studs are delicate by design — appropriate for a newborn's tiny lobes, easy for a parent to manage. The BIS Hallmark certification means you know exactly what the child is wearing.

For the Namkaran, a pair of simple gold studs with a small natural stone — pearl, for purity, or ruby for warmth — is a gift that photographs beautifully and carries meaning far beyond its size.

Annaprashan (First Solid Food Ceremony) — Pendant

Annaprashan — a child's first feeding of solid food — is typically celebrated between the fifth and seventh month. In Bengali families this is the Mukhe Bhaat; the ceremony has regional variations across India but carries the same significance: a turning point in the child's first year.

This milestone calls for something personal rather than something wearable immediately. A pendant, meant to be kept and worn as the child grows, is a gift calibrated to the occasion.

A fine gold pendant — a small symbol, a nature motif, or a piece set with a natural gemstone — can be gifted now and worn from toddlerhood. It has a longer life than earrings given at birth, and it represents the family's intention to mark every stage, not just the first one.

Rakhi — Earrings or a Pendant for the Sister

Rakhi is the one festival in the Indian calendar explicitly dedicated to siblings. A brother ties a rakhi on his sister's wrist; she prays for his wellbeing. The gift traditionally flows back from brother to sister.

For a brother gifting a young sister — particularly when the gift comes from parents purchasing on behalf of an older sibling — fine children's jewellery is a more meaningful choice than toys or sweets. It is a gift that will be remembered when Rakhis come and go in future years.

A pair of small gold earrings with a coloured gemstone — amethyst, ruby, or a natural diamond — is a practical and beautiful Rakhi gift. It is small enough to be within accessible price points, distinctive enough to carry the occasion.

Alternatively, a pendant on a fine gold chain makes a Rakhi gift that a slightly older child (ages two and above) can wear with pride.

What is BIS Hallmark and why does it matter for a children's jewellery gift?

BIS Hallmark is India's government-backed gold purity certification, issued by the Bureau of Indian Standards. A BIS Hallmark stamp on a piece confirms that the gold meets the declared karat standard — 14K or 18K — without guessing or trusting the seller's word. For a children's jewellery gift, BIS Hallmark certification means the recipient's family can verify exactly what the child is wearing.
